Types of Amazon Whole Foods Jobs Available

The vast network of Amazon Whole Foods locations offers a diverse range of employment opportunities, catering to individuals with varying skill sets and career aspirations. Understanding the different types of positions available is a crucial first step in the job search process.

In-Store Positions

These roles are the backbone of the Whole Foods shopping experience. Cashiers are the first point of contact for customers, providing friendly and efficient service. Stocking associates are responsible for ensuring that shelves are well-stocked and organized, contributing to a visually appealing and functional store environment. The produce team member plays a vital role in maintaining the quality and freshness of the produce department, carefully selecting and displaying a wide variety of fruits and vegetables.

Meat and seafood team members require specialized knowledge and skills to handle and prepare these perishable items, ensuring food safety and quality. The bakery team member crafts delectable baked goods, from bread and pastries to cakes and cookies, delighting customers with their culinary creations. Those working as prepared foods team members create ready-to-eat meals, salads, and other convenient options for busy customers.

Specialty team members, often experts in specific areas such as cheese or wine, guide customers through the selection process, offering knowledgeable recommendations and pairings. Customer service associates address customer inquiries, resolve complaints, and ensure a positive overall shopping experience. Finally, team leaders and supervisors oversee the operations of various departments, providing guidance and support to team members while ensuring smooth and efficient workflow.

Delivery and Distribution Center Roles

The growth of online grocery shopping has led to an increased demand for delivery and distribution center roles. Delivery drivers, often using the Amazon Flex or Whole Foods delivery services, are responsible for safely and efficiently transporting groceries to customers’ homes. Warehouse associates work within distribution centers, organizing and managing inventory, preparing orders for shipment, and ensuring timely delivery. Order fulfillment specialists focus on accurately and efficiently processing online orders, ensuring that customers receive the correct items in a timely manner.

Corporate and Management Roles

Beyond in-store and delivery positions, Amazon Whole Foods also offers a variety of corporate and management roles. Store managers are responsible for the overall operations of a Whole Foods store, overseeing all aspects of the business, from staffing and inventory to customer service and profitability. Assistant store managers support the store manager in day-to-day operations, assisting with various tasks and responsibilities.

Regional managers oversee multiple stores within a specific geographic area, ensuring consistency in operations and performance. Marketing and sales positions focus on promoting Whole Foods products and services, developing marketing campaigns, and driving sales growth. Human resources professionals are responsible for recruiting, hiring, and managing employees, ensuring a positive and productive work environment. Those in finance and accounting handle financial planning, budgeting, and reporting, ensuring the financial health of the company. Finally, technology roles involve developing and maintaining the technology infrastructure that supports Amazon Whole Foods operations, ensuring efficiency and innovation.

Qualifications and Requirements

To succeed in the Amazon Whole Foods job market, it’s essential to understand the qualifications and requirements for different positions. While specific requirements may vary depending on the role, certain general qualifications are typically expected.

General Requirements

Applicants must generally meet a minimum age requirement, typically at least sixteen or eighteen years old. A high school diploma or GED is often required, particularly for more advanced positions. Background checks are standard practice to ensure the safety and security of the workplace. Many roles require a certain level of physical fitness, as they may involve lifting, standing for extended periods, and performing repetitive tasks.

Specific Skill Requirements

Customer service skills are highly valued in customer-facing roles, as is the ability to interact with customers in a friendly and helpful manner. Excellent communication skills are essential for effective teamwork and collaboration. Product knowledge, particularly about natural and organic foods, is often a plus, especially for roles involving customer interaction or product selection. Teamwork and collaboration skills are crucial for working effectively within a team environment. Problem-solving skills are also highly valued, as employees are often required to address customer concerns or resolve operational issues.

Certifications and Licenses

Depending on the specific role, certain certifications or licenses may be required. Food handler’s permits are often necessary for positions involving food preparation or handling. A valid driver’s license is required for delivery driver roles.

Preferred Qualifications

Prior retail experience is often considered a valuable asset, as is experience in the food industry. A passion for healthy living and sustainable practices can also set candidates apart.

Benefits of Working at Amazon Whole Foods

Working at Amazon Whole Foods offers a comprehensive package of benefits, designed to attract and retain top talent.

Competitive Pay

Amazon Whole Foods offers competitive hourly rates, commensurate with experience and position. Opportunities for raises and bonuses are often available, rewarding employees for their hard work and dedication.

Health and Wellness Benefits

Comprehensive health insurance coverage, including medical, dental, and vision insurance, is typically offered to eligible employees. Paid time off, including vacation and sick leave, allows employees to maintain a healthy work-life balance. Employee assistance programs provide confidential support for employees facing personal or professional challenges.

Financial Benefits

Amazon Whole Foods offers a retirement savings plan, such as a four-oh-one(k), with a company match, helping employees save for their future. Employee stock options may be available for certain roles, providing employees with an opportunity to share in the company’s success. Generous discounts on Whole Foods products allow employees to enjoy healthy and delicious food at a reduced price.

Career Development Opportunities

Comprehensive training programs equip employees with the skills and knowledge necessary to succeed in their roles. Opportunities for advancement are available, allowing employees to progress within the company and build their careers.

Other Perks

Flexible scheduling options may be available in some cases, providing employees with greater control over their work-life balance. A positive work environment, characterized by teamwork and collaboration, fosters a sense of community and belonging.

How to Find and Apply for Amazon Whole Foods Jobs

Finding and applying for Amazon Whole Foods jobs is a straightforward process. Here’s a step-by-step guide:

Official Amazon Job Website

The official Amazon job website is the primary resource for finding Amazon Whole Foods job openings. Utilize the search functionality to find jobs in your desired location and department. Refine your search using keywords and filters, such as “Whole Foods,” “cashier,” or “delivery driver.”

Whole Foods Market Careers Website

The Whole Foods Market careers website may also list specific job openings at Whole Foods locations. It is worth checking alongside the Amazon website.

Indeed, LinkedIn, and Other Job Boards

Explore job boards such as Indeed and LinkedIn for additional Amazon Whole Foods job opportunities. These platforms can provide access to a wider range of listings.

Application Process

Begin by creating an Amazon account, if you don’t already have one. Carefully complete the online application form, providing accurate and detailed information. Craft a compelling resume and cover letter, highlighting your relevant skills and experience.

Interview Process

Prepare for potential interviews, which may be conducted by phone, in person, or virtually. Practice answering common interview questions, focusing on your experience, skills, and motivations.
